Pune: Global management consulting and technology firm ZS has released its ZS India Sustainability Report 2024, showcasing the company’s expanding footprint in social impact and environmental responsibility.
Through its ₹9.3 crore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R) commitment, ZS partnered with 20 nonprofit organizations, touching over 85,655 lives across India.
The ZS India sustainability report details a broad range of Environmental, Social, and Governance (ESG) initiatives focused on healthcare, education, women’s economic empowerment, and sustainability.
With active engagement from 2,246 employee volunteers contributing 7,663 hours, ZS is reinforcing its mission to drive meaningful change and create equitable opportunities for underserved communities.
“This impact would not have been possible without the dedication of ZSers and our NGO partners,” said Rohit Bhagwat, Office Managing Principal at ZS and a global ESG working group member. “We’re not just supporting change—we’re leading it. Our goal is to build a future where everyone can thrive.”
Key Highlights from the ZS India Sustainability Report 2024:
Healthcare:
- In partnership with Jivika Healthcare, 1,200 adolescent girls in Pune received HPV vaccinations to reduce cervical cancer risk.
- Collaborations with Jeevan Stambh Foundation and Seva Arogya Foundation facilitated health camps and OPD clinics in Delhi and Pune, benefiting 12,500+ underserved individuals.
- ZS worked with the Rotary Club to upgrade the Maternity and Neonatal Ward at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el Cantonment Hospital, supporting over 2,000 women and newborns.
Education & Digital Inclusion
- Partnered with ROBOTEX India to deliver STEM education to 1,200 students from urban, rural, and tribal schools.
- ZScholarship launched in Pune in 2020 and expanded to Delhi and Bengaluru, offers up to ₹50,000 per student annually for specialized undergraduate programs in partnership with Seva Sahayog and Buddy4Study.
Women’s Economic Empowerment
- In collaboration with Seva Sahayog Foundation, ZS trained women in sewing and tailoring, enabling financial independence and job opportunities.
Environment and Sustainability
- Reinforcing its commitment to climate action, ZS partnered with Green Yatra Trust to plant 500 native saplings at Gawali Udyan in Pune using the Miyawaki afforestation method.
